1. Start by Sharing What You Know
People don’t just buy products or services.
They buy confidence in your ability to help them get away from pain or toward a desire.
One of the easiest ways to build this trust is by consistently showing up with value.
What is value?
Whether you’re sharing insights on social media, creating blog posts, filming a YouTube tutorial, or offering guidance and knowledge through a newsletter, like this one, you build authority every time you show up and help someone solve a problem, share an insight, or give a piece of wisdom.
Action Step: Choose your favorite platforms to focus on and start sharing valuable content at least once a day. For most of you reading this, that’s Instagram and Threads.
This week, share a personal story, a lesson learned, or a practical tip to help others move forward in your domain.
Keep it consistent.
Remember, authority is built over time. Not overnight.
2. Embrace Your Unique Voice and Perspective
You don’t need to sound like everyone else.
In fact, trying to fit the mold of someone else often backfires.
Your community is drawn to you because of your unique voice, experience, and approach. When you embrace what makes you different, you stand out naturally and effortlessly.
Action Step: Take five minutes to write down three to five things that make you and your approach unique. It might be your directness, your sense of humor, or your focus on practical steps over fluff.

4. Engage with Your Audience
Authority is a two-way street.
At the end of the day it’s not just about putting content out there. It’s about building a relationship with the people you want to serve.
Engage with your community, ask questions, and encourage feedback. These interactions build trust and loyalty which naturally lead to authority.
Action Step: This week, ask your audience a question that invites them to share their thoughts or experiences. You’ll gain valuable insight into their needs and start to forge stronger connections.
Whether it’s in your email replies, social media comments, or a poll, listen to what they’re saying and use it to shape future content.
